lay-off

[ˈleɪ ɒf]
  • 释义
  • 临时解雇期; 失业期;

  • 双语例句
  • 1、

    He went on attacking her until other passengers arrived and told him to lay off.

    他不停地打她,直至其他乘客过来叫他住手。

    柯林斯例句
  • 2、

    an eight-week lay-off with a broken leg

    因腿部骨折歇工休养八周

    《牛津高阶英汉双解词典》
